Weinan Wang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ology and Obstetrics and Gynec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Weinan Wang has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 691 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Immunology and 5 papers in Obstetrics and Gynecology. Recurrent topics in Weinan Wang's work include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(5 papers),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(4 papers) and Plant Molecular Biology Research (4 papers). Weinan Wang is often cited by papers focused on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(5 papers),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(4 papers) and Plant Molecular Biology Research (4 papers). Weinan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Australia. Weinan Wang's co-authors include Minghua Deng, Liang Chen, Yong Jiang, Ning Li, Shu Wang, Peng‐Fei Tu, Liang Zhang, Shepo Shi, Jan Perlich and Christine M. Papadakis and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, PLANT PHYSIOLOGY and Food Chemistry.
